Sneaker release 2026: Nike Air Force 1 '07 LX Vibram 'Silt Red' (IH1943-600)
The Air Force 1 needs no introduction, but the version LX Vibram is something different. The color 'Silt Red', a desaturated and earthy pink, covers a premium leather upper resting on an oversized Vibram sole. It's not just an aesthetic detail: the Vibram sole guarantees grip and wear resistance impossible for a standard AF1. It is the ideal shoe for those seeking a robust look with sophisticated tones, perfect to pair with dark denim or technical cargo pants.

Sneaker release 2026: Air Jordan 5 Retro 'White Metallic' (HQ7978-103)
One of the most anticipated drops of the month is undoubtedly the Jordan 5 'White Metallic'. Featuring an optical white upper and a reflective 3M tongue, this sneaker keeps the iconic silver "shark teeth" on the black sole. It is a shoe with a strong visual impact, recalling the aggressive '90s aesthetic but with the cleanliness of modern materials. A piece of history that cannot be missing in a Jordan collection.
Sneaker release ASICS 2026: UB13-S Gel-SD Lyte curated by Kiko Kostadinov Studio
The collaboration between ASICS and the studio of Kiko Kostadinov is now a guarantee for those looking for niche, top-level sneakers. The UB13-S Gel-SD Lyte reworks the Japanese brand's archive through a contemporary filter.
The two colorways planned for April, 'Kelp Sage' (green and moss tones) and 'Olive Grey Rust Orange' (olive grey with orange accents), show obsessive care in color matching. Glossy synthetic materials alternate with wide-grain mesh, creating a complex and layered shoe.
